AB 1823: State government: State Government Strategic Planning and Performance and Review Act: strategic plans: equity.

California · Assembly · 2025–2026 Regular Session · last verified May 16, 2026

What AB 1823 does, verified May 16, 2026

The bill requires each state agency or department to develop a strategic plan to advance racial equity. The plan must include a description of elements to be included and a process for developing and adopting the plan. Agencies must report to the governor and the joint legislative budget committee by April 1 each year on the steps taken to develop and adopt a strategic plan. Before implementing any budget or regulation, agencies must undertake a racial equity analysis. If an agency does not have a diversity, equity, and inclusion officer, the analysis must be performed by an individual with expertise in specified areas, including analyzing public policies that impact racial equity. This ensures that state government operations are more inclusive and equitable.
